Bleach: The Blade of Fate
Think MvC2-style combat/combo system with Bleach characters. It's probably the best handheld fighter I will ever play and I was playing the JPN release with a FAQ printed out. The problem is the 2nd game is coming out sooner or later so only get this on the cheap.
